Hindi Sharabi (1964)

Sharabi is a classic Bollywood movie released in the year 1964, directed by Raj Rishi and featuring a star-studded cast including Dev Anand, Madhubala, and Lalita Pawar in pivotal roles. The film’s narrative revolves around the life of a man battling alcoholism, showcasing the highs and lows of his journey. The music for Sharabi was composed by the renowned Madan Mohan, with lyrics penned by Rajendra Krishan. This combination brought to life songs that have stood the test of time and are still celebrated.

The soundtrack of Sharabi is notable for its melodious tracks, sung by some of the most iconic singers of the era, including Mohammed Rafi and Asha Bhosle. The songs from the movie, such as “Kahin Na Kahin“, have become evergreen hits, contributing significantly to the film’s success and legacy in Indian cinema. Among the standout tracks from the movie are ‘”Tum Ho Haseen Kahan Ke“, “Jao Ji Jao” and “Do Do Haath Do Do Paon” each adding a unique flavor to the film’s soundtrack. The movie generated a gross income of est. ₹4 million worldwide at the box office.
